Cube & Star, N1
A very cool bunch, including electronic/guitar trio Ulterior are behind this Hoxton party, whose playlist consists of music performed, produced or written by David Bowie. Ulterior themselves, who have a single out this week, will also be taking the stage. (020 7739 8824). Tonight, 8pm-1am.

The Old Queen's Head, N1
It's a night of hip-hop flavour up in Islington with much vaunted 24-year-old turntablist A Skillz delivering the kind of mixes that have seen him tour Australia and host the VIP room at Live 8. Focussing on old school rap with a spot of Eighties electro, all interspersed by cuts and scratches, his marathon DJ set should be a corker. (020 7354 9993). Tonight 7pm-2am.
Mish Mash
Cargo, EC1
This unique monthly has developed an impressive following thanks to an onthe-pulse, eclectic music policy and consistently well-chosen live acts. The organisers of the club are also a band, also called Mish Mash, whose first single, the disco-flavoured Speechless, went down extremely well on dancefloors. Expect to hear this and new material as they take the stage. (020 7749 7840). Sat 5 Aug, 8pm-3am.
